Safety and Efficacy of Oral Semaglutide Versus Dulaglutide Both in Combination With One OAD in Japanese Subjects With Type 2 Diabetes
In Brief
A Phase 3 clinical trial evaluating Semaglutide and Dulaglutide for Diabetes and Diabetes Mellitus, Type 2. Completed, enrolled 458 participants across 34 sites.
Detailed Summary
This trial is conducted in Asia. The aim of this trial is to investigate Safety and efficacy of oral semaglutide versus dulaglutide both in combination with one OAD (oral antidiabetic drug) in Japanese subjects with type 2 diabetes.

Interventions
Semaglutidedrug
Oral administration once-daily, as add-on to pre-trial oral antidiabetic drug (OAD).
Dulaglutidedrug
Subcutaneously administration (s.c., under the skin) once-weekly, as add-on to pre-trial oral antidiabetic drug (OAD).
